#429c32 Color Information

In a RGB color space, hex #429c32 is composed of 25.9% red, 61.2% green and 19.6%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 57.7% cyan, 0% magenta, 67.9% yellow and 38.8% black. It has a hue angle of 110.9 degrees, a saturation of 51.5% and a lightness of 40.4%. #429c32 color hex could be obtained by blending #84ff64 with #003900. Closest websafe color is: #339933.

#429c32 color description : Dark moderate lime green.

#429c32 Color Conversion

The hexadecimal color #429c32 has RGB values of R:66, G:156, B:50 and CMYK values of C:0.58, M:0, Y:0.68, K:0.39. Its decimal value is 4365362.

Shades and Tints of #429c32

A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#030702 is the darkest color, while #f8fdf8 is the lightest one.

Tones of #429c32

A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#636c62 is the less saturated color, while #21cc02 is the most saturated one.
